Choosing your favorite gown online can be faster and cheaper, but do so well in advance to allot extra time for alterations. A certain person claims to have spent only $100 or her gown, but had to spend another $200 to get it altered. The cost of an alteration should also be included in your budget.

Makeup Artist Carefully
Select your makeup artist carefully. Be sure to view his or her work before hiring. Do you like their style? So choose a makeup artist carefully and consider having them do your makeup in a test session weeks before the wedding. You don’t want to find yourself with makeup that doesn’t appeal to you right before you are about to start your wedding.
If you’re one of the many people who don’t want to spend upward of a thousand dollars on a fat-and-sugar-laden wedding cake, check with local bakeries for lighter, individual-sized wedding pastry suggestions. For example, cupcakes can be made to be gluten-free, topped with fruit, or include artificial sweeteners.

Silk flowers are a great alternative to some of the different types of flowers that you can purchase for your wedding. Because they’re synthetic, you don’t have to wait until the last minute to purchase them, eliminating your concerns about floral arrangements on your wedding day.
Dress children in comfortable clothes if they are in your ceremony. Favor soft fabrics, and avoid dressing children in clothes that are too tight to fit comfortably. If they are going to have new shoes, you should let them wear them a few times before the ceremony to break them in. Taking care of these small details will allow children to focus on participation in the wedding instead of fussing with their attire.
If your reception doesn’t include dinner, you can save money by reducing the number of tables and spending that money to rent furniture. If you use comfortable furniture like lounge chairs or fancy sectional pieces, your guests might spend more time socializing with each other. Comfortable seating will make your guests feel relaxed and at home, permitting them to enjoy lounging areas around your location.

Use floral arrangements of varying heights. Use vases that are tall for long stem and compact head flowers. You can then surround the vases using flowers with more show and volume but that are shorter. Short and tall blooms can help to distinguish your wedding.
